What it costs to live in Davenport.

Median household income: $64,497 — +36.2% since 2015 (not adjusted for inflation)

Median gross rent: $930/mo — +31.5% since 2015

What it means

The typical household here earns $64,497 — notably lower than the national figure of $78,538.

The typical renter here spends 30.0% of household income on rent, above the 30% level housing agencies use to define cost burden.

Since 2015, income has kept pace with rent here (+36.2% versus +31.5%), before adjusting for inflation.
